Job Summary The Mechanical Engineer is responsible for the design, analysis, and implementation of mechanical systems and components. This role supports projects from concept through construction, installation, testing, and commissioning while ensuring compliance with applicable codes, safety standards, and project specifications. The Mechanical Engineer collaborates with internal teams, consultants, and contractors to deliver efficient, cost-effective, and high-quality engineering solutions.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
Design, develop, and review mechanical systems including HVAC, plumbing, piping, mechanical equipment, and related components
Prepare engineering calculations, drawings, specifications, and technical documentation
Review and interpret architectural, structural, and electrical drawings to ensure system coordination
Support project planning, scheduling, budgeting, and cost control efforts
Conduct site visits to observe installation progress, resolve field issues, and verify compliance with design documents
Review shop drawings, submittals, and RFIs for mechanical scope
Ensure designs comply with applicable codes and standards (ASHRAE, ASME, NEC, NFPA, local building codes)
Coordinate with contractors, vendors, and suppliers to resolve technical issues
Perform system testing, commissioning support, and performance evaluations
Identify opportunities for value engineering and energy efficiency improvements
Maintain accurate project records and provide technical reports as required
